Hopefully, someday, Ill be able to get track one out of my head. This Ann Arbor based Afrobeat/Fusion octet is ready to hit the road now that their fans have basically forced them into the national eye with an onslaught of persuasive emails to jazz labels. They are finally ready to hit the road with Detroit favorite His Name is Alive, and lets hope they speak well of us back in Michigan because everyone’s going to be listening to their raw propulsive rhythms and infectious melodies. -Pete
